William Bendix (1906-1964) with a Colt Model 1903 Pocket Hammerless as Buzz Wanchek in The Blue Dahlia.

William Bendix can be seen using the following weapons in the following films and television series:

Film

Gun Character Film Note Date
Smith & Wesson Military & Police Jeff The Glass Key 1942
Colt M1911 Pvt. Aloysius K. Randall Wake Island 1942
Browning M2 Water Cooled
Model 16 Stielhandgranate
Colt Model 1903 Pocket Hammerless Buzz Wanchek The Blue Dahlia 1946
Flintlock Pistol Ben Worley Blackbeard, the Pirate 1952
Colt Official Police Lawrence C. Trumble Macao 1952
